Transaction faa3ff39db92a20f931068eb99d2f953600da29f794ba50678cb52fd0609ef17
1 Input
2 Outputs
- faa3ff39db92a20f931068eb99d2f953600da29f794ba50678cb52fd0609ef17:0
- faa3ff39db92a20f931068eb99d2f953600da29f794ba50678cb52fd0609ef17:1
value 32708
address 37sdm9zwa65umrj1LbmGLok3EaZGrvLwgZ
value 52230523
address 3MGAP2FWrDrxRxZ5zSYQjsZLmtotrcn2sd